Description
If you're looking for a solid road cycling workout near the 434 E / Ridgehaven area, the "Roadbike loop from 434 E / Ridgehaven" offers a moderate challenge. This route covers 31.1 miles (50.1 km) with 1751 feet (534 metres) of elevation gain, typically taking around 2 hours and 22 minutes to complete. It's a good option for experienced road cyclists seeking a consistent ride without overly technical sections.
What to expect on Roadbike loop from 434 E / Ridgehaven
While specific scenic details for this particular loop are not widely documented, road cycling routes in regions like Broome County, New York, often feature a mix of rolling hills and open stretches, providing a good test for your legs. You can expect a steady effort throughout the ride, with the elevation gain spread across the distance rather than concentrated in steep climbs. This makes it suitable for riders who enjoy maintaining a rhythm and pushing their endurance. The route is best suited for those comfortable with moderate distances and elevation, offering a rewarding experience for intermediate road cyclists.
